Career Awards

1. Lifetime Achievement Award given by World Congress on Clinical and Preventive Cardiology (WCCPC) conferred by Dr. A. P. J. Abdul Kalam in 2006
2. Rastriya Ratan Award by International Study Circle in 2005

 
 
 
 
Other Professional Information

I started robotic cardiac surgery programme at Escorts Heart Institute in December 2002 and since then performed 450 robotic cardiac cases with excellent results.
Besides clinical work I am actively involved in research and already published more than 75 scientific papers and chaired scientific sessions in national and international conferences in USA, UK, China, Italy, Japan, France and Far East Countries.
I have already operated more than 1200 cases with port access technology.
Another area of my interest is redo cardiac surgery and I have already performed more than 650 redo cardiac cases.
